Jurgen Klopp has backed Loris Karius following his pre-season blunder against Tranmere Rovers.

Liverpool continued to gear up for the new season with a game against the League Two outfit on Tuesday. And while the Premier League side came out victorious, Karius' mistake grabbed all the headlines.

The German keeper is probably still having nightmares about his mistakes in last season's Champions League final and ahead of the new campaign, he continues to be in calamitous form.

He fumbled the ball from a free-kick into the path of a Tranmere player who scored.

Tranmere's Ben Tollitt rubbed salt into the wounds by shouting 'you're f*cking sh*t' in Karius' direction. Brutal.

Despite people on Twitter bombarding Karius with disparaging comments, Klopp has defended his keeper.

"Mistakes will happen; I don't like it, he doesn't like it," he said.

Klopp reckons Karius 'could' have saved the shot though admitted it was "not easy to deal with".

Klopp added: "Let's carry on and make the best of all these situations by learning from them."

The German boss has already dipped into the transfer market, shelling out millions to acquire the services of Naby Keita (pre-contract agreement) and Fabinho.

He's actively looking for a new No.1 with the likes of Jack Butland and Alisson Becker among those reportedly catching his eye.

Though the AS Roma star is supposedly set to sign for Real Madrid who are also hellbent on drafting in a new keeper.
